Allegro使用技巧大全:从新手到专家

需积分: 21 16 下载量 180 浏览量 更新于2024-07-15 2 收藏 843KB PDF 举报
"记住这58条Allegro使用技巧,秒变大神!.pdf" 在电子设计自动化(EDA)领域,Cadence Allegro是一款广泛使用的PCB设计软件,它提供了高级的功能和强大的设计工具。以下是一些Allegro使用技巧,帮助用户提升效率和准确性: 1. **鼠标设定**:为了防止在执行指令后鼠标自动跳转到Option窗口,可以在控制面板的鼠标设置中,取消“在对话框中将鼠标指标移到预设按钮”的选项,使布局过程更加流畅。 2. **Textpath设置**:如果在ALLEGRO中遇到无法执行某些指令的情况,如Show element或Tools>Report,可以尝试复制对应的log文件到工程目录下,或者在Setup>UserPreference中设置Design_Paths>textpath为正确的路径,例如C:cadancePSD_14.1sharepcb/text/views。 3. **NetLogic编辑**:默认情况下,NetLogic可能不允许编辑。要启用这一功能,需在Setup>UserPreference中找到logic_edit_enabled选项,并将其设置为允许编辑。 4. **Gerber输出前的DRC检查**:在转出Gerber文件之前,确保更新DRC检查。对于一些可忽略的DRC错误,可以通过创建新的subclass来解决,比如将Logo中的文字移出ETCH层,或者为特定的PIN添加“NO_DRC”属性以避免DRC错误。 5. **NODRC属性的应用**:"NODRC"属性不适用于相同网络,若要消除同一网络的DRC错误,需要设置SamenetDRC为关闭状态。 6. **创建新subclass**:通过Setup>Subclass菜单,可以定义新的subclass,例如用于放置标题和页码的Top_notes、Bottom_notes等。这有助于在Gerber输出中管理不同信息。 7. **差分对nets的空间类型设置**:对于差分对nets,需要正确设定“netspacetype”属性,以确保信号之间的间距符合设计规范。这通常涉及调整差分对之间的间距和相对位置,以优化信号完整性和减少干扰。 8. **其他实用技巧**:熟练使用快捷键可以大大提高效率;了解并定制个人的工作环境,包括颜色主题和布局;掌握规则驱动设计(RDD),利用设计规则来自动检查和修正问题;学习如何创建和应用自定义宏,以重复复杂的操作;理解和使用层堆叠管理器,以有效地管理多层板的设计。 以上是Allegro使用的一些基础和进阶技巧,掌握这些技巧将有助于提高设计的精确度和速度,同时减少错误和返工。不断实践和探索Allegro的更多功能,可以帮助用户成为真正的专家。